I’ve been working on a editing style guide for my works. A style guide is a book that contains principles and tips for editing, both in a big picture way, and from line to line. Most of my style guide pertains to my own writing quirks and problems, but I thought I’d share with you my lists of words to avoid or to check for repetition.
Feel free to copy it, and add your own problem words.
